Award season in Hollywood is officially underway, and we’re already seeing several new and gorgeous hairstyles come out of it. We’ve recently wrapped up the People’s Choice Awards and the Golden Globes, and we’ve loved the do’s celebs chose for those events. We saw a nice mix of styles, some of them chosen no doubt for the People’s Choice Awards due to rain, and we’re expecting similar variety when it comes to the upcoming Oscars.

The following are five hairstyle successes from the red carpets of the People’s Choice Awards and the Golden Globes that we think are most noteworthy. These fab hairstyles will surely give inspiration to stars wondering what to wear for the big night, as Awards Season 2016 continues with The Oscars.

1. Julianne Hough

For the People’s Choice Awards, Julianne Hough wore a sleek topknot, which we’re guessing was due in part because of the rain. The simple and controlled style was perfect for taming any frizzies that might have come about from drizzles and even downpours. Hough opted to let one straight accent strand hang out for visual appeal, which we think was a great choice.

2. Dakota Johnson

Dakota Johnson, who won a People’s Choice Award for Favorite Dramatic Movie Actress, chose to rock side-swept bangs and loosely tousled waves. We think she looked effortlessly gorgeous on a day where precipitation was a huge concern.

3. Alicia Vikander

Nominated for The Danish Girl, Alicia Vikander looked amazing at the Golden Globes with a sophisticated up-do that included some intriguing twisted sections, too. Overall, the Golden Globes showed off some ultra-glam styles from celebrities, and Vikander’s style fit right in.

4. Sophia Bush

The One Tree Hill actress pulled her blonde bob into a tidy baby ponytail for the Golden Globes. We think Sophia Bush probably surprised a lot of people with her choice of clean, side part combined with sporty tie-up, and think others might follow suit.

5. Laverne Cox

Not to be outdone, Laverne Cox’s sexy ombre waves caught the eye of many onlookers at this year’s Golden Globes. She wore this trendy style perfectly, too, as she channeled classic Hollywood vixens and the most stylish femme fatales of the industry’s past.
